Convert between energy units, volumetric units, or across categories using fuel-specific energy densities.
This free calculator supports 18 energy units including kilowatt-hours (kWh), British thermal units (BTU), therms, megajoules (MJ), kilocalories, and pounds of steam (at 970 BTU/lb). It also converts between 11 volumetric units such as gallons, liters, cubic feet, and cubic meters. Use the fuel-specific mode to calculate energy content for natural gas, propane, diesel, gasoline, kerosene, and ethanol based on standardized energy density constants.
Energy unit conversion is essential for facility managers comparing utility bills across fuel types, engineers validating building energy models, and sustainability teams calculating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ions. This calculator eliminates manual lookup tables and conversion factor errors — enter a value in any supported unit and see instant results across all compatible units.
Common use cases include converting natural gas therms to kWh for benchmarking, calculating BTU output from steam flow measurements, translating diesel fuel consumption into megajoules for carbon reporting, and comparing propane energy content against electricity costs per unit of delivered energy.

Common Energy Equivalents
| Unit | Equivalent |
|---|---|
| 1 kWh | 3,412 BTU |
| 1 therm | 100,000 BTU = 29.3 kWh |
| 1 MMBTU | 293.07 kWh = 10 therms |
| 1 GJ | 277.78 kWh = 947,817 BTU |
| 1 CCF natural gas | ≈ 103,000 BTU ≈ 1.03 therms |
| 1 US gallon diesel | ≈ 138,500 BTU ≈ 40.6 kWh |
